Superstate provides tokenized real-world assets, including legally issued public-company equities and yield-bearing funds, held onchain in investors' own wallets. It serves institutional and qualified-purchaser investors through an onboarding and portfolio-management portal that connects to DeFi protocols on Ethereum, Solana, and Plume.

Company profile
researched Aug 2026Superstate provides infrastructure for moving funds and stocks onto public blockchains, connecting securities with crypto capital markets for global, around-the-clock access and DeFi use cases. Its FundOS product is aimed at asset managers who want to tokenize existing private funds, mutual funds and ETFs on compliant rails, with features such as continuous access, stablecoin integration and broader utility for deployed capital. Tokenized funds listed on the platform include the Invesco Short Duration US Government Securities Fund (USTB) and the Bitwise Crypto Carry Fund (USCC).
A second product line, Opening Bell, tokenizes company stock and enables capital raising on Ethereum and Solana. Superstate states that tokenized shares issued through Opening Bell are the same shares that trade on traditional exchanges such as Nasdaq or NYSE, rather than derivatives, wrappers or new share classes. Companies listed in this program include Galaxy Digital Inc. (GLXY) and Forward Industries, Inc. (FWDI). Investors can use the platform to access yield-bearing tokenized funds and tokenized shares of listed companies.
Business model
Superstate operates a platform used by asset managers to tokenize fund products and by companies to tokenize shares and raise capital, while offering investors access to the resulting tokenized funds and equities.

Market position
Superstate positions itself around the growth of onchain capital markets, which it describes as having scaled to hundreds of billions of dollars, and works with established asset managers and listed companies such as Invesco, Bitwise, Galaxy Digital and Forward Industries.
The company emphasizes that its tokenized equities represent the same shares traded on traditional exchanges rather than derivatives or wrappers, combined with built-in compliance controls at the token level and direct issuance without intermediaries.
Technology
The platform issues tokenized securities on public blockchains including Ethereum and Solana, with token-level permissioning, allowlisted wallets and programmatically enforced transfer restrictions applied to every transaction, enabling peer-to-peer transfer and instant settlement within a compliant framework.
Go-to-market
Superstate markets two product lines directly to issuers: FundOS for asset managers upgrading existing funds onto onchain rails, and Opening Bell for companies tokenizing stock and raising capital, including a Direct Issuance Program in which issuers set terms, investors receive tokenized shares and ownership is recorded on public blockchains through an SEC filing.
